Understanding the complexities of chiropractic medical billing:

Chiropractic medical billing is unlike billing in many other healthcare specialties. It’s not just about submitting claims, it’s about navigating a system filled with codes, insurance caps, compliance rules, and constant regulatory updates. Without a tailored approach, practices risk losing valuable revenue and getting bogged down in administrative work instead of focusing on patients.

Coding challenges

Every claim hinges on accuracy. CPT codes, modifiers, and diagnosis codes must align perfectly, or reimbursement is at risk. Even minor errors can lead to rejected claims or delayed payments, problems that quickly add up in a busy chiropractic office.

Insurance limitations

Many payers impose strict caps on chiropractic visits. Others require prior authorizations before extended care can continue. If these limitations aren’t managed carefully, practices face denied claims and patients face unexpected bills, hurting both trust and revenue.

DME billing

Chiropractors often provide Durable Medical Equipment like braces or therapeutic supports. But DME billing is notoriously complex. It comes with specialized codes, additional compliance requirements, and extra documentation. Without precision, reimbursements are easily lost.

Ever-changing regulations

Insurance policies and government regulations shift constantly. What was valid six months ago may not apply today. Staying compliant requires ongoing updates, staff training, and constant monitoring. Missing these changes exposes practices to audits and claim denials.

Patient communication gaps

Chiropractic billing also involves clear communication with patients. Many don’t understand coverage limits, co-pays, or why certain treatments aren’t fully covered. If practices don’t proactively explain billing, it can create confusion and dissatisfaction.

High denial rates

Because of strict payer rules and coding complexity, chiropractors often face higher-than-average claim denial rates. Without effective denial management, old AR piles up, reducing cash flow and creating unnecessary stress.

Proven strategies to maximize chiropractic revenue:

  1. Submit clean claims the first time

    Every denied claim is revenue delayed. The key to faster payments is accuracy at submission. Implement internal audits, double-check coding, and leverage medical billing software that flags errors before claims are sent. The fewer resubmissions, the healthier your cash flow.

  2. Master denial management

    Denials should not be viewed as dead ends but as diagnostic tools. A strong denial management process helps identify patterns, whether it’s missing modifiers, incomplete documentation, or payer-specific quirks. By addressing the root causes, practices can prevent denials from recurring and recover otherwise lost revenue.

  3. Leverage technology and automation

    Modern chiropractic billing software helps automate repetitive processes such as eligibility verification, claim scrubbing, and payment posting. This not only reduces human error but also saves staff time. More importantly, automation ensures that small mistakes, like a missing digit in a policy number, don’t turn into big revenue delays.

  4. Strengthen documentation practices

    Strong documentation is the lifeblood of chiropractic billing. Insurers require detailed notes proving medical necessity. Chiropractors should ensure that SOAP notes are complete, precise, and linked directly to billed services. This strengthens compliance and reduces audit risks.

  5. Optimize DME billing

    Billing for DME services requires meticulous attention to coding, prior authorizations, and compliance with payer-specific guidelines. Missteps here often lead to costly denials.   6. Train your staff continuously

    Billing rules evolve constantly. A team that isn’t updated on the latest payer requirements is more likely to make costly mistakes. Regular training sessions ensure staff are equipped to handle compliance changes, coding updates, and payer policies.
